Luscher and Polytype SA sign distribution deal

CTP manufacturer Luscher has signed a "global distribution partnership" with Polytype SA, the South American arm of packaging print systems manufacturer Wifag Polytype.

Polytype SA will benefit from the addition of Luscher's UV platesetters to its product range, which includes dry offset printing systems for plastic containers, decorating systems for plastic tubes, and production lines for metal packaging.

Polytype SA's portfolio includes dry offset, waterless, heat transfer, flexo, screen and digital print technology, in addition to hot and cold stamping and various finishing options.

At Drupa, Luscher launched the XDrum! UV, a new 8-up CTP system combining its imaging technology with a Heidelberg Suprasetter chassis that was billed as an "economical" platesetter for printers producing mid-format offset plates.

This was shown alongside the Swiss pre-press manufacturer's Accent coating plate for offset applications and its large-format MultiDX! 240 system, which can process plates up to 1,300x1,100mm and is designed for use with rigid and flexible screen printing forms.

The machine can expose both flexographic, offset and letterpress plates at a resolution of 5,080dpi for use in hot foil, embossing and punching applications.

Anton Tanner, chief operating officer at Luscher, said: "In Polytype SA, we have an exceptionally well-established partner whose international market leadership in a sector in which we have not previously been active will open up long-term opportunities for us."
